Former Lt. Gov. Mandela Barnes and his team are discussing dropping out of the crowded Democratic primary for Wisconsin governor, according to two people with direct knowledge of the matter.

The conversations come as Democratic officials in the state brace for damaging media reports about Barnes expected to hit in the coming hours. Barnes and his team have been on calls Thursday to discuss how to proceed, according to the people, granted anonymity to share private details.

The primary had become increasingly messy as more moderate leaning Democrats like Barnes have tried to stave off Democratic socialist Francesca Hong’s rise, worried her victory could boost presumed Republican nominee Tom Tiffany. Wisconsin Gov. Tony Evers’ endorsement of David Crowley — who reentered the race in the final stretch — further complicated the moderate coalition.

A spokesperson for Barnes’ campaign did not immediately respond to a request for comment.
